Selecting the Perfect Coffee Table Foundation
Begin your holiday styling journey by choosing a coffee table that serves as an ideal canvas for your festive design. Consider tables with wooden surfaces or metallic accents that naturally complement the red and gold color palette. Opt for materials like:
- Polished marble with gold veining
- Dark wood with metallic undertones
- Glass tables with gold-toned metal frames

Centerpiece Styling Techniques
Craft a mesmerizing centerpiece that becomes the focal point of your coffee table. Combine elements that reflect holiday sophistication:
- Crystal bowl filled with gold and red ornaments
- Elegant hurricane glass with pillar candles
- Metallic figurines in complementary tones
Natural Elements
Blend organic touches with your red and gold theme by introducing natural elements that add warmth and texture. Consider:
- Pine cones spray-painted in gold
- Burgundy poinsettia arrangements
- Dried branches with metallic accents
Lighting and Ambient Accents
Enhance the magical atmosphere with strategic lighting and reflective surfaces. Introduce:
- Fairy lights with warm golden hues
- Mirrored trays to amplify light
- Metallic candle clusters

Practical Application in Holiday Decor
Implementing red and gold requires thoughtful consideration. Start with neutral base colors like cream or white to prevent overwhelming the space. Introduce these vibrant colors through:
• Throw pillows
• Table runners
• Decorative candle holders
• Artwork
• Ceramic or glass accessories
Recommended color ratios typically follow the 60-30-10 design rule:
- 60% neutral base color
- 30% secondary color (red)
- 10% accent color (gold)

Textural Layering Techniques
Mixing different fabric weights and textures adds dimensionality to living spaces. Combine smooth silk with chunky knit blankets, creating visual intrigue and tactile experiences. Wool, cashmere, and velvet materials provide luxurious sensory experiences while maintaining aesthetic cohesion.
Lighting Transformation Strategies
Ambient lighting significantly impacts room perception. Soft, warm-toned LED candles, strategically placed table lamps, and dimmable overhead fixtures create inviting atmospheres. Consider amber-tinted bulbs that emit warm, golden glows reminiscent of fireplace comfort.

Professional Styling Recommendations
Interior design professionals suggest rotating 20-30% of existing accessories seasonally. This strategy maintains fundamental room structures while introducing refreshed visual narratives.

Practical Tips for Creating Luxurious Coffee Table Displays
Understanding the Foundations of Stylish Displays
Creating a luxurious coffee table display starts with selecting the right base elements. Choose a high-quality tray as an anchor piece that grounds your arrangement. Opt for materials like marble, brass, or mirrored surfaces that add instant sophistication. A well-chosen tray helps organize smaller decorative items and creates visual structure.
Layering Techniques for Visual Interest
Professional designers recommend incorporating multiple heights and textures to create depth. Consider these strategic layering approaches:
-
• Stack coffee table books with beautiful covers facing outward
• Introduce decorative objects with varying heights
• Mix metallic and matte finishes for dynamic contrast
• Include organic elements like small sculptural pieces or botanicals

Practical Placement Strategies
Ensure your coffee table display remains functional. Leave enough open space for practical use, such as setting down drinks or creating conversational areas. Aim for a composition that feels intentional yet effortless.
Material and Texture Considerations
Experiment with diverse materials to create visual intrigue. Combine elements like:
| Material | Visual Impact |
|---|---|
| Brass | Adds warmth and sophisticated metallic sheen |
| Marble | Introduces elegant, timeless texture |
| Natural Wood | Provides organic, grounding element |
Maintaining Balance and Proportion
Professional designers recommend following the rule of thirds. Create visual triangles with your decorative objects, ensuring no single area feels too heavy or cluttered. This approach helps maintain a sense of harmony and intentionality.
